Fabrication of cr4+,nd3+: yag transparent ceramics for self-q-switched laser

英文摘要Transparent 0.1 at.%cr, 1.0 at.%nd:yag (y3al5o12) ceramics were fabricated by a solid-state reaction and vacuum sintering with cao as a charge compensator and tetraethyl orthosilicate (teos) as a sintering aid using high-purity powders of al2o3, y2o3, nd2o3 and cr2o3. the mixed powder compacts were sintered at 1800 degrees c for 5 h and 30 h under vacuum. the optical transmittance of the cr,nd:yag ceramics sintered at 1800 c for 5 h and 30 h is similar to 63% and similar to 78% in the infrared wavelengths, respectively. the two samples exhibit pore-free structures and the average grain size is about 10 and 20 mu m. for the sample sintered at 1800 degrees c for 5 h, the dominant fracture mechanism is the transgranular fracture. with increase of holding time up to 30 h the ratio of intergranular fracture surfaces increase and more cr3+ ions in the cr,nd:yag ceramic transform to cr4+. high-quality cr4+,nd3+:yag transparent ceramics may be a potential self-q-switched laser material.
